Gentoo Archives: gentoo-commits

From: Sergei Trofimovich <slyfox@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: dev-haskell/ekg-json/
Date: Sat, 14 Dec 2019 23:47:32
Message-Id: 1576367242.6ddef11e246921bf4ce3b8f007ac222f89011db9.slyfox@gentoo
1 commit: 6ddef11e246921bf4ce3b8f007ac222f89011db9
2 Author: Sergei Trofimovich <slyfox <AT> gentoo <DOT> org>
3 AuthorDate: Sat Dec 14 23:23:53 2019 +0000
4 Commit: Sergei Trofimovich <slyfox <AT> gentoo <DOT> org>
5 CommitDate: Sat Dec 14 23:47:22 2019 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=6ddef11e
7
8 dev-haskell/ekg-json: bump up to 0.1.0.6-r1
9
10 Package-Manager: Portage-2.3.81, Repoman-2.3.20
11 Signed-off-by: Sergei Trofimovich <slyfox <AT> gentoo.org>
12
13 dev-haskell/ekg-json/Manifest | 1 +
14 dev-haskell/ekg-json/ekg-json-0.1.0.6-r1.ebuild | 36 +++++++++++++++++++++++++
15 2 files changed, 37 insertions(+)
16
17 diff --git a/dev-haskell/ekg-json/Manifest b/dev-haskell/ekg-json/Manifest
18 index c871848a20b..a32cdebc491 100644
19 --- a/dev-haskell/ekg-json/Manifest
20 +++ b/dev-haskell/ekg-json/Manifest
21 @@ -1,3 +1,4 @@
22 DIST ekg-json-0.1.0.0.tar.gz 2969 BLAKE2B d16870858a80ae7a95bfce3e948dfc2e7b8f1501e3246a448486087a38fced0f36cac3f732c5b4f73a0a3102955685f0d9902b01a82c40c377e3e3a515dad871 SHA512 6d9d2a5f7d8893cc9076b6817bf433fa3e525fe08e2686c7e21f0a58d8c0699f4a16859f3042e4d3aa0e79416301d43cac21fe80b767934ab9f0309f02558c51
23 DIST ekg-json-0.1.0.1.tar.gz 2966 BLAKE2B 3656c910ce6fdd84e13027314c4334a641808fc4b0e42007ce9cd1b1954198395845161f09076207269b2270b955a4849b3b1a654742ba914cda98ab4df86f6d SHA512 c1ec9c0feedffdc7ff50997b5a851237507e0f9d2e841fa9cae5785dc26318abe1a3a0de9c433e3554a686869fa26a756a85d1cdae4bce6af198cfc641c1d508
24 DIST ekg-json-0.1.0.3.tar.gz 3069 BLAKE2B 6683dba514dd62608cdbf3e5291a0216ec4aaec89d2e652721b8fa06819138dfa409d05ed364a18c3113bf2a04c7ed7f24e0e019e29b3eb62505fc01b59c026b SHA512 52f03c9758396a627a4b5c9a92aacb84e5f082ff5ecbfba2a5f870c0abe9d7c81d65a7a8f0ce16558634a3cc6fdd4834efed8dc95c73fed9a1b2aea049660ff9
25 +DIST ekg-json-0.1.0.6.tar.gz 3094 BLAKE2B ea5755f2cabb8c898a6632fdf0cebca99a8eccc4a9ba2e3f844781d029b5c11d618c67bbcadbece93a69e092c03cfedef7e435fbed2998497ab44ab034a82a34 SHA512 c1996214f3d41202dd51a3bf335fa6c67488a3b3625acba196839bef36eff1443907c010b6887845cf759addc769b45d1bcc648554bb2a7942a13337cf40c60e
26
27 diff --git a/dev-haskell/ekg-json/ekg-json-0.1.0.6-r1.ebuild b/dev-haskell/ekg-json/ekg-json-0.1.0.6-r1.ebuild
28 new file mode 100644
29 index 00000000000..058d32387d9
30 --- /dev/null
31 +++ b/dev-haskell/ekg-json/ekg-json-0.1.0.6-r1.ebuild
32 @@ -0,0 +1,36 @@
33 +# Copyright 1999-2019 Gentoo Authors
34 +# Distributed under the terms of the GNU General Public License v2
35 +
36 +EAPI=6
37 +
38 +# ebuild generated by hackport 0.5.3.9999
39 +
40 +CABAL_FEATURES="lib profile haddock hoogle hscolour"
41 +inherit haskell-cabal
42 +
43 +DESCRIPTION="JSON encoding of ekg metrics"
44 +HOMEPAGE="https://github.com/tibbe/ekg-json"
45 +SRC_URI="https://hackage.haskell.org/package/${P}/${P}.tar.gz"
46 +
47 +LICENSE="BSD"
48 +SLOT="0/${PV}"
49 +KEYWORDS="~amd64 ~x86"
50 +IUSE=""
51 +
52 +RDEPEND=">=dev-haskell/aeson-0.4:=[profile?]
53 + >=dev-haskell/ekg-core-0.1:=[profile?] <dev-haskell/ekg-core-0.2:=[profile?]
54 + <dev-haskell/text-1.3:=[profile?]
55 + <dev-haskell/unordered-containers-0.3:=[profile?]
56 + >=dev-lang/ghc-7.4.1:=
57 +"
58 +DEPEND="${RDEPEND}
59 + >=dev-haskell/cabal-1.10
60 +"
61 +
62 +src_prepare() {
63 + default
64 +
65 + cabal_chdeps \
66 + 'base >= 4.5 && < 4.11' 'base >= 4.5' \
67 + 'aeson >=0.4 && < 1.3' 'aeson >=0.4'
68 +}